Tellurian is a treatment facility that specializes in addressing addiction and mental illness using a team-based approach. The organization employs Medical, Clinical, and Management Teams that collaborate to meet each patient's needs. Their combination therapy approach, which they call "dual diagnosis," integrates medical treatment and counseling. The facility offers multiple levels of care including detoxification, residential programs, day treatment, outpatient services, and community housing services. Tellurian operates care centers in multiple locations including Dane County and La Crosse.

Relapse prevention

Relapse Prevention. Identifies your specific high-risk situations, warning signs, and choice points. Then builds a written, rehearsed plan for each so the moment is not the first time you decide.
